<h2>Drain Line Setup Made Easy: Water Softener System Installation Guide

Setting up a water softener drain line isn't complicated if you follow key requirements. We always use ½-inch ID tubing, maintain that critical 1.5-inch air gap above the drain opening, and guarantee our line runs less than 30 feet with proper slope. Avoid common mistakes like skipping the air gap or using undersized tubing that causes clogs. With monthly inspections and regular maintenance, you'll prevent headaches that many homeowners face with improper installations.

  • Use ½-inch ID tubing rated for 3-7 GPM or Schedule 40 PVC for reliable drain line installation.
  • Maintain a 1.5-inch air gap above the drain opening to prevent back-siphoning and ensure code compliance.
  • Keep drain lines under 30 feet in length and below 8 feet in elevation to avoid back-pressure issues.
  • Secure all connections with quality compression fittings and hose clamps to prevent potential leaks.
  • Ensure proper slope of at least ¼ inch per foot for effective drainage and prevent mineral buildup.

Understanding Water Softener Drain Line Requirements

When it comes to installing a water softener in your home, the drain line might seem like a minor detail, but trust me, it's one of the most critical components for proper operation.

first image
Don't underestimate the drain line—it's the unsung hero of your water softener installation.

We've seen countless DIY installations fail because homeowners overlooked proper drain line setup. Remember, you'll need a minimum 1.5-inch air gap above the drain opening—this isn't just a suggestion, it's code compliance that prevents contamination of your drinking water.

Use ½-inch ID tubing or Schedule 40 PVC for your drain line, keeping it under 30 feet in length and below 8 feet in elevation.

We've learned the hard way that ignoring these specs leads to backpressure issues. Guarantee your line slopes at least ¼ inch per foot and secure all connections without over-tightening.

Essential Materials and Tools for Proper Installation

Three key materials make all the difference between a water softener that works flawlessly and one that causes headaches for years.

First, ½ inch ID tubing rated for 3-7 GPM is non-negotiable—we've seen countless systems fail from inadequate flow capacity.

Next, Schedule 40 PVC pipe should be your go-to for permanent installations; it's what we use in our own homes to handle pressures up to 110 psi without worry.

Don't forget quality compression fittings! We've learned the hard way that cheap connectors lead to midnight leaks.

Your toolbox should include a precision tubing cutter (scissors won't cut it), adjustable wrenches, and a trusty level to guarantee that 1.5-inch air gap and proper drainage slope.

Trust us—these essentials will save you from costly emergency plumber visits.

Step-by-Step Drain Line Installation Process

Before diving into any drain line connections, we'll need to shut off your home's main water supply completely—a step we've seen skipped far too often with disastrous results.

Trust us, there's nothing worse than an unexpected indoor waterfall in your utility room!

Next, connect the ½-inch flexible tubing to your softener's drain valve using a hose clamp—make it tight, but don't crush it.

Secure that tubing with a properly-tensioned hose clamp—tight enough for security, gentle enough to preserve the line's integrity.

We'll route this line toward your discharge point with a minimum ¼-inch slope per foot and a vital 1.5-inch air gap above the drain's flood rim.

Remember, avoid kinks and keep the line under 30 feet long and below 8-foot elevation.

Use compression fittings at connection points—snug, not strangled.

We've saved countless installations by conducting a thorough leak check afterward and recommend annual line flushes to prevent mineral buildup.

Common Mistakes to Avoid During Setup

Now that we've tackled the drain line installation, let's explore the pitfalls that can turn your water softener setup into a home improvement nightmare.

We once helped a neighbor whose basement flooded because he skipped that vital 1.5-inch air gap at the drain outlet—back-siphoning contaminated his drinking water! Don't make this mistake.

We've also seen countless DIYers use undersized tubing (thinner than ½ inch), creating frustrating clogs that required complete reinstallation.

Remember to secure all connections tightly; even tiny leaks can silently damage your home's foundation over time.

Watch your elevation too—drain lines more than 8 feet above the discharge point create back-pressure issues we've struggled to fix ourselves.

And please, schedule regular inspections for kinks and blockages. Your future self will thank you!

Frequently Asked Questions

How to Connect a Water Softener Drain Line?

We'll connect your water softener drain line using ½-inch ID tubing, ensuring a 1.5-inch air gap above the drain rim, then route it with a gentle slope to your discharge point.

Where Does the Water Softener Drain Line Go?

We'll direct your water softener drain line to an approved discharge point like a laundry sink, floor drain, or standpipe. We've found maintaining that 1.5-inch air gap is essential for safety.

How Far Can You Run a Drain Line for a Water Softener?

We've found 30 feet is the maximum distance for water softener drain lines. We'll remind you to maintain that 1.5-inch air gap and keep elevation below 8 feet for ideal performance.

Does a Water Softener Drain Need an Air Gap?

Yes, we absolutely need an air gap! We've learned the hard way that a 1.5-inch minimum gap prevents backflow contamination. Trust us, protecting your drinking water from sewage is non-negotiable.
